Mary Weber Obituary

Mary Weber of Montevideo died on Wednesday, January 8, 2020 at Divine Providence Health Center in Ivanhoe, MN at the age of 71.

Memorial services will be held on Monday, August 3, 2020 at 11:00 AM at Our Saviors Lutheran Church in Montevideo with Rev. Donald S. McKee officiating. Visitation with the family will be one hour before the service at the church.   Social distancing will be observed at the church and all in attendance must wear a mask.  

A livestream of the service will appear on Mary's obituary page on Monday, August 3, 2020 at 11:00AM.

Mary June Weber was born in Montevideo, MN to Herman and Leona (Hermanson) Weber on July 18, 1948.  She was baptized and confirmed at Our Saviors Lutheran Church in Montevideo.  Mary attended and graduated from Montevideo High School.  She then went on to attend college at Moorhead State University, majoring in Education.  She returned to Montevideo where she was a teacher in the Montevideo district.  Mary would eventually  become an Educational Resource Specialist with the Educational Service Cooperative.  She worked  for the Cooperative for over 41 years.  During that time, she would specialize in providing educators with resources for special needs children.

Mary was active at Our Saviors Lutheran Church, singing in the choir and serving on various committees.  She was very community minded and was active on the Library Board and other community organizations bringing people together to make the community a better place to live.  She enjoyed bowling, was a avid reader and loved all kinds of music.  By far her greatest passion was the love for her son, Jason and her grandson, Jayson.  When Jason was growing up Mary didn’t miss one of his activities and sporting events.  She could be seen and heard cheering in the football stands in different towns and in all kinds of weather to see Jason play football, first for Montevideo and then for the University of Minnesota Morris.  She always looked forward to spending time with her grandson, Jayson.  One of  her greatest joys was when Jayson would visit her at Hillstreet in Marshall and play bingo, talk with the other residents and just “hang out” with his grandma.

Mary is survived by her son, Jason (Kahla) Weber, Lowry, MN; grandson, Jayson Weber, Hancock, MN; mother, Leona Weber, Montevideo; sister, Barbara (Yves) Pinkowitz, Yorba Linda, CA; brothers: James Weber, Denver, CO, Robert (Kathy) Weber, Reston, Virginia, Greg (Belinda) Weber, Montevideo, MN; niece and nephew: Jackie and Danny Pinkowitz, Yorba Linda, CA;  as well as extended family and friends.

Mary was preceded in death by her father, Herman Weber.
